General Description  
Features  
The MAX3752 quad-port bypass IC is designed for use  
in the Fibre Channel Arbitrated Loop topology. This  
device consists of four serially connected port bypass  
circuits (PBCs) and a repeater that provides clock and  
data recovery (CDR).

The quad-port bypass circuit allows connection of up to  
four Fibre Channel L-Ports, which can each be enabled  
or bypassed by controlling the PBC select inputs.  
Additional quad PBCs can be cascaded for applica-  
tions requiring more than four L-Ports. To reduce the  
external parts count, all signal inputs and outputs have  
internal termination resistors.

The MAX3752 complies with Fibre Channel jitter toler-  
ance requirements and can recover data signals with up  
to 0.7 unit intervals (UIs) of high-frequency jitter. When  
the repeater is not needed, it can be disabled to reduce  
power consumption. A fully integrated phase-locked loop  
(PLL) provides a frequency lock indication and does not  
need an external reference clock.
